was out 2day on a new lake never fished it before anyway i was doing a bit of roach fishing, took me up until 2 oclock to have my 1st roach, haveing moved around the lake 5 times, then managed to catch 9 more nice roach until it all came to a sudden stop!!! some local angler came around and told me there was a loads of pike in the venue!!! and the they loved the live bait!!!! so out came the pike rod with a live roach on(1st time i have done this!) had 5 takes all in the space of 1 hour, only hooked into three of them and landed 2 , the first one was around 7lb mark the other one i landed was around 10lb,
so not bad day fishing and it was free .
